About Nuffield Health Plymouth Hospital:
Located in Derriford, adjacent to our Devonshire Gym, our hospital has been part of the Plymouth community since 1971. We offer:
* 3 main theatres (2 laminar flow, 1 digital)
* A fully JAG-accredited endoscopy suite
* A 35-bed ward with private and shared bays
* 12 consulting rooms in our outpatient department
* Specialties including Orthopaedics, Plastic Surgery, and Neurosurgery
We're proud to be ranked among the top 50 hospitals in the UK for total hip replacement outcomes.
